A Comprehensive Thalassemia Prevention and Control Plan

At the launch of the Thalassemia Prevention and Control Master Plan for the next decade, Vice President Hussain Mohamed Latheef highlighted the critical role of blood donation in supporting individuals with thalassemia. Speaking at the event, he expressed that blood donation should be a joyful act, serving as a lifeline for affected children.

Vice President Latheef underscored the importance of healthcare for children with thalassemia, advocating for equal opportunities in society. He called on the public to contribute by donating blood, which is vital for these children’s survival.

He also praised President Dr. Mohamed Muizzu's commitment to improving healthcare services for thalassemia patients, particularly through the establishment of a specialized hospital. This initiative, driven by compassion, aims to reduce the suffering of families dealing with this condition.

During the ceremony, an agreement was signed for the construction of the thalassemia hospital in Hulhumale’ Phase 2. Meadow Asia and Chin Hin Group Berhad were awarded the contract, with the Health Minister, Abdulla Nazim Ibrahim, signing on behalf of the Maldivian government. The project financing has been arranged by Sinoma Industry Engineering Company.

The planned facility will include a three-story layout featuring an emergency room, canteen, children’s playground, laboratory, blood transfusion unit, radiology department, and a blood and organ transplant unit. This new hospital is part of President Muizzu's pledge to enhance healthcare for thalassemia patients, ensuring they receive the necessary services sustainably.
